Output 7f86267001dbe574a1799ca729cfabe608677e5182129f2a2440b93c65f8dd1d:1

value
405844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a66989863e3c02bfb557fc7e5a887ae66c53bf21 OP_EQUAL
address
3GrvXEwS2qRpakUtqhmgFE4Jkjir2hNhF2
transaction
7f86267001dbe574a1799ca729cfabe608677e5182129f2a2440b93c65f8dd1d
confirmations
439194
spent
true